Biochem/physiol Actions

3,4-Dehydro-L-proline methyl ester is C-terminal blocked 3,4-Dehydro-L-proline (3,4-DHP). 3,4-Dehydro-L-proline is used as a substrate and inhibitor of various enzymes. 3,4-Dehydro-L-proline may be used to inhibit extensin biosynthesis. 3,4-Dehydro-L-proline is a alternate substrate of the amino acid oxidase, NikD. 3,4-Dehydro-L-proline inhibits collagen secretion by chondorcytes.
